我正在使用Access数据库。我正在尝试编写一个查询,让用户选择开始和结束日期。以下是标准下的设计视图中的查询:
[输入日期自(mm / dd / yyyy)]和[输入日期至(mm / dd / yyyy)]
之间在04/01/2011和05/12/2011之后,Access数据库中的结果与以下查询中的结果不同。
SELECT SOMETHING
FROM MY TABLE
WHERE SOLD_DATE >=04/01/2011'
AND SOLD_DATE <'05/13/2011'
访问:16,564条记录
MS查询:16,573条记录
我猜这是假设是上午12点的时间。如何让查询一直包括结束日期到晚上11:59?
非常感谢!
答案 0 :(得分:1)
它们不是同一个查询。你应该包括两个极端:
SELECT SOMETHING
FROM MY TABLE
WHERE SOLD_DATE >='04/01/2011'
AND SOLD_DATE <='05/13/2011'
答案 1 :(得分:0)
但是#please之间的日期。
SELECT SOMETHING
FROM MY TABLE
WHERE SOLD_DATE >= #04/01/2011#
AND SOLD_DATE <= #05/13/2011#